OBJECTIVES In monoamniotic twin pregnancies discordant for fetal anomaly, parents may opt for selective feticide. However, the normal co-twin remains at risk of sudden demise from cord entanglement. We report on three cases of successful selective feticide by cord occlusion combined with cord transection. BACKGROUND Blood loss and the requirement of blood transfusions during liver transection have been shown to correlate well with higher morbidity and mortality rates and a worse prognosis. Various devices for liver parenchymal transection have been developed to reduce intraoperative blood loss. Through producing a variety of cytotoxic factors upon activation, microglia are believed to participate in the mediation of neurodegeneration. Intervention against microglial activation may therefore exert a neuroprotective effect.
